body{margin:0;width:100%;height:1283px;background-color:#0c1615;overflow-x:hidden}.wrap{width:100%;display:flex;align-items:center;justify-content:center;background-repeat:no-repeat;background-size:cover}.pc{width:100%;max-width:2560px;height:1283px;background-size:2560px 1283px;background-image:url(/pmhdt-tournament-ad-banner/pc_2560_bg_contents.png);background-repeat:no-repeat;background-position:center;position:relative}.logo,.bi,.footer{position:absolute}.we{display:block}.mo{display:none}.logo{left:70px;top:47px;z-index:1}.bi{right:70px;top:60px;z-index:1}.footer{width:100%;display:flex;align-items:center;justify-content:center;bottom:30px}.button-link{width:100%;position:absolute;display:flex;align-items:center;justify-content:center;bottom:333px}.button-link a{margin-right:8px}.mobile{display:none;width:450px;height:1530px;background-size:450px 1530px;background-image:url(/pmhdt-tournament-ad-banner/mo_720_bg_contents.png);background-repeat:no-repeat;background-position:top center;position:relative}.close,.mobile-size .mo.close{display:none}.mobile-size .close img{width:30px}.mobile-size .close{position:absolute;z-index:1;top:15px;right:10px}.mobile-size .mo.bi{display:none}body.mobile-size{height:1530px}.mobile-size .we{display:none}.mobile-size .mo{display:block}.mobile-size .pc{display:none}.mobile-size .mobile{display:block}.mobile-size .bi img{width:66px}.mobile-size .bi{top:25px;right:10px}.mobile-size .logo{top:15px;left:10px}.mobile-size .logo img{width:51px}.mobile-size .wrap{background-image:url(/pmhdt-tournament-ad-banner/mo_1540_bg_contents.png);background-size:770px 1532.5px;background-position:center}.mobile-size .button-link{bottom:253px;flex-direction:column}.mobile-size .button-link a{margin-bottom:10px;margin-right:0}.mobile-size .button-link a img{width:333px}.mobile-size .footer{left:0;bottom:20px}.mobile-size .footer img{width:200px}.mobile-size .wrap-header{width:100%;position:absolute;height:40px;display:flex;align-items:center;justify-content:center}.mobile-size .wrap-header .inner{max-width:770px;width:100%;position:relative}
